Question
In a previous post you allowed a hot plate to be used if used before Shabbat. Does this apply even if the food is yet not cooked? If yes,why is this different than an stove top without a blech-both are the normal way of cooking, for even though the hot plate has a coverd heating unit this is the normal way it cooks and should not be considered a "heker". Or were you only talking about reheating fully cooked food that does not require a "heker" or blech? Thank you
